Nestled in the picturesque landscape of Kent, Cuxton train station serves as a convenient gateway for travelers looking to explore the quaint village of Cuxton and beyond. While modest in size, this station offers the essential facilities and connections that make travel seamless and enjoyable.
Cuxton station, though lacking a traditional ticket office, boasts the convenience of ticket machines, allowing passengers to purchase and collect their tickets with ease. Situated by the entrance to platform 1, these machines ensure accessibility for all passengers. An induction loop is also available to aid hearing-impaired travelers, and the station features a customer help point, providing vital information and support.
As for accessibility, while parts of the station offer step-free access, it’s important to check specific routes in advance. Step-free access is available to a selection of platforms via the car park and level crossing, and assistance can be arranged both on trains and through a pre-booked mobile assistance team. Although Cuxton lacks facilities such as luggage storage, refreshments, and waiting rooms, it offers a seating area for those awaiting their train.
Travelers can conveniently extend their journey beyond Cuxton thanks to several transport links available. For those heading towards Maidstone, a bus stop located on Sundridge Hill opposite Bush Road is easily accessible. Similarly, a bus stop opposite the White Hart pub serves those travelling towards Strood. This ensures connectivity with the wider transport network.

Located in the heart of the West Midlands, Sandwell & Dudley train station serves as a vital transit hub for both locals and those traveling further afield. Whether you're planning a short commute or an adventure to a distant city, this station offers a variety of routes and amenities to make your journey seamless and enjoyable. Let’s dive into what makes Sandwell & Dudley a great choice for your rail travel needs.
The station offers essential facilities to ensure a smooth journey. The ticket office, open from early morning until late evening, provides both in-person ticket sales and machines for convenient online ticket collection. It’s important to note that while the ticket machines are available, they are not accessible for all. However, the station does feature step-free access to all platforms, making it user-friendly for passengers with mobility challenges.
Safety and assistance are priorities at Sandwell & Dudley. Staff are available to help during the operating hours of the ticket office, and the station is equipped with CCTV for added security. For personalized travel assistance, you can rely on the Passenger Assist service, which allows for assistance bookings up to two hours before travel. Luggage storage isn’t available, but rest assured, the Secure Station Scheme accreditation underlines its commitment to passenger security.
The station is well-connected to other modes of transportation, enhancing your travel flexibility. For those occasions when rail replacement services are required, buses operate from the station entrance on McKean Road. A variety of local taxi services, such as Sandwell, Dudley, and Oldbury taxi companies, ensure that you can reach your next destination with ease.
While there aren't facilities on-site for refreshments or shops, nearby areas offer options for dining and shopping, allowing you to stretch your legs and grab a bite or two. Note that the station lacks public Wi-Fi and pay phones, so plan accordingly, especially if connectivity is crucial for your travels.
